Heterosis
is a term used in genetics and selective breeding.
The term heterosis, also known as hybrid vigor or
outbreeding enhancement, describes the increased strength
of different characteristics in hybrids; the possibility
to obtain a genetically superior individual by combining
the virtues of its parents.
A mixed-breed dog Heterosis is the opposite of inbreeding
depression, which occurs with increasing homozygosity.
The term often causes controversy, particularly in
terms of the selective breeding of domestic animals,
because it is sometimes believed that all crossbred
animals are genetically superior to their parents;
this is true only in certain circumstances : when
a hybrid is seen to be superior to its parents, this
is known as hybrid vigor. When the opposite happens,
and a hybrid inherits traits from their parents that
makes them unfit for survival, the result is referred
to as outbreeding depression.
The
dominance hypothesis attributes the superiority of
hybrids to the suppression of undesirable recessive
genes from one parent by dominant genes from the other.
It attributes the poor performance of inbred strains
to loss of genetic diversity, with the strains becoming
purely homozygous at many loci.
Certain combinations of genes that can be obtained
by crossing two strains are advantageous in the hybrid
vigor.
